Why this petition matters

There are two resolutions being considered by the Town Council to annex property into the town and develop high-density housing and businesses. Both of these are on Rt 225 near Quailwood Dr.
Resolution 22-05 – Hawthorne Yards – Proposed nearly 200 homes, town homes and businesses. The hearing date for this resolution is currently set for July 18th, at 6:00pm both virtually and at the Town Hall. La Plata - Meeting Information (civicweb.net). The time to act is NOW!
AND
Resolution 22-01 - The HUB at LaPlata – Proposed nearly 1600 homes, plus businesses destroying over 5M square feet of forest and a fragile ecosystems. There is no infrastructure being added to support this. Think of all the congestion and strain to public services and schools!
The Public hearing has already occurred, and public record closed. But you can still call (301-934-8421) and / or email the Mayor and Town Council members and tell them to vote AGAINST the annexation when it comes to a vote.
